You are correct and you told him this already. The thing is, his oily intake runners are before the head ports, not after. Unsealed rocker arm bolt holes will leak oil in the combustion and not generally get sucked back up in the intake ports. That does seem like a lot of oil for a catch can to handle. How long did you run it with the line from the valve cover plugged and why did you plug it up to begin with?

Hi Folks
There is a vacuum in the intake so I don’t think oil in the head would get inside the intake unless it is under pressure. You would suck it into the cylinder and burn it. One way to make sure you are not suck oil thru the PCV hose is to disconnect it and plug it going into the intake. See if the smoking is cut down. How much oil are you losing?
